Resolution No. 1145RESOLUTION NO. 1145
A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F CYPRESS
COMMENDING MR. MICHAEL MAY FOR HIS QUICK ACTIONS IN
HELPING TO SAVE THE LIFE OF MRS. JOYCELYN TORGERSON.
WHEREAS, Michael May, 18 years of age, has been a resident of the City
of Cypress since 1968, and is currently a senior at Western High School; and
WHEREAS, on January 6, 1971, an emergency arose in the home of Mrs. Joycelyn
Torgerson, residing in the home adjacent to that of Michael May; and
WHEREAS, upon viewing Mrs. Torgerson's unconscious and unbreathing condition
immediately contacted the Rescue Squad; and
WHEREAS, his alert thinking was acknowledged by the hospital staff as being
critical in helping to save Mrs. Torgerson's life; and
WHEREAS, Mrs. Joycelyn Torgerson has advised the Cypress City Council of
this heroic act.
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ED that the City Council of the City of Cypress
hereby commends Michael May for his quick and heroic actions In helping to save
the life of Mrs. Joycelyn Torgerson on January 6, 1971.
PASSED AND ADOPTED by the City Council of the City of Cypress at a regular
meeting held on the 8th day of February, 1971.
